The game will be McClaren's first competitive fixture at St James' Park, and could see him call on signings of Aleksandar Mitrovic, Chancel Mbemba and Georginio Wijnaldum. Mitrovic is the strongest player of the three and a lot is expected of him. With Newcastle being barely over relegation under John Carver last season, McClaren wants to usher in a new era on Tyneside with a positive showing. Southampton have an unusual injury concern over manager Ronald Koeman. 
The Dutchman injured his achilles in training earlier this week, but he was present for their Uefa Europa League progression at Vitesse on Thursday. While he recovers from the surgery, Koeman will miss his side's opener against on Saturday. His assistant and brother, Erwin, will take charge at St James's Park.
